若一个查询同时涉及到两个以上的表,称为连表查询准备表create table department(id int auto_increment PRIMARY KEY,name varchar(20));departmentcreate table employee(id int primary key auto_increment,name varchar(20),sex enum('male'
目录条件查询语法 条件创建stu表 查询列表 查询地址信息   去除重复记录  关键字:DISTINCT查询姓名,数学,英语成绩  条件查询查询年龄大于20岁的学员信息 查询年龄大于的等于20岁的学员信息 查询年龄大于的等于20岁并且小于等于30岁的学员信息 查询入学日期到'19
文章目录:1.查询员工的姓名、年龄、部门信息(隐式内连接) 2.查询年龄小于30岁的员工的姓名、年龄、职位、部门信息(显示内连接)3.查询拥有员工的部门id、部门名称4.查询所有年龄大于40岁的员工,及其归属的部门名称;如果没有分配部门,也需要展示出来5.查询所有员工的工资等级6.查询‘研发部’所有员工的信息及工资等级(两种写法)7.查询‘研发部’员工的平均薪资8.查询工资比‘灭绝’高的
转载 2024-04-21 15:16:29
175阅读
文章目录一、MySQL基础语句1、去重复,区间,升降序,函数,分页查询2、显隐内连接,嵌套,日期3、外键4、系统函数5、日期相关6、自定义函数7、crud8、存储过程9、视图10、union和union all的区别11、触发器12、修改表字段二、MySQL原理1.MySQL存储引擎2.MySQL索引(是 帮助快速高效查找数据的数据结构)3.MySQL事务特性和隔离等级4.MySQL的锁 一、M
第一章概念模型(ER图)椭圆是属性 矩形是实体 菱形为联系概念模型到关系模型转化主码下面要加下划线1-m联系实体型->关系模式 将1端主码连同联系属性放入n端属性中1-1联系实体型->关系模式 任意一端主码连同联系属性放入到另外一端实体当中n-m联系实体型->关系模式 产生一个新关系,关系名为联系名,将两端实体的主码连同关系属性数据库系统的三级模式结构概念数据库的三级模式结构是由
Mysql中的DQL查询语句   1、查询所有列 --查询 学生 表所有记录(行) select *from 学生   --带条件的查询 select *from 学生 where 年龄>19   2、查询指定的列 --查询 所有人的姓名和性别 select 姓名,性别 from 学生   --查询 所有 年龄>19 的学生的
一、子查询         子查询:(嵌套查询)一个select 语句中包含另一个 select 语句 -- 查询所有比张三年龄大的其他学生 select * from student where age > (select age from student where name = '张三')
# MySQL 查询小于30天的数据 MySQL是一种开源的关系型数据库管理系统,广泛应用于Web开发中。在使用MySQL进行数据查询时,经常需要根据特定条件筛选出符合要求的数据。本文将介绍如何在MySQL查询小于30天的数据,并提供相应的代码示例。 ## 什么是小于30天的数据 在数据库中,日期和时间是常见的数据类型之一。如果我们想查询小于30天的数据,实际上是想查询日期在当前日期前30
原创 2024-02-15 05:11:33
851阅读
# 如何实现 Python 输入年龄的要求:值大于16且小于30 在本篇文章中,我们将指导你如何在 Python 中实现一个简单的程序,它要求用户输入一个年龄,并确保该年龄大于16且小于30。通过这次学习,你将掌握基本的输入输出处理、条件语句的使用,以及如何进行数据验证。 ## 整体流程 在开始编码之前,我们首先要明确实现这个需求需要经过哪些步骤。下面是一个简单的流程表: | 步骤 |
原创 11月前
142阅读
数据库优化 学习笔记一、条件查询 where 1.1、比较运算符(>,<,=,<=,>=)-- > -- 查询 大于18岁 的信息 select * from students where age > 18; -- < -- 查询小于18岁的信息 select * from students where age < 18; -- =
4.MySQL查询-- 查询 -- 查询所有字段 -- select * from 表名; select * from students; -- 查询指定字段 -- select 列1,列2,... from 表名; select name,age from students; -- 使用 as 给字段起别名 -- select
在使用 MySQL 进行数据查询时,我们可能需要提取特定条件的数据,例如查询年龄大于 30 岁且按升序排列的记录。这样的问题在数据分析和报告中非常常见。在本文中,我们将详尽记录解决“mysql 查询年龄大于30岁并且升序”的过程,从问题的背景出发,分析出现的错误现象,寻找根因,并给出详细的解决方案和后续的验证措施。 ```mermaid flowchart TD A[开始] --> B{
原创 7月前
67阅读
# 如何实现mysql查询时间小于30天的数据 ## 一、流程图 ```mermaid stateDiagram [*] --> 开始 开始 --> 连接数据库 连接数据库 --> 查询数据 查询数据 --> 显示结果 显示结果 --> 结束 结束 --> [*] ``` ## 二、步骤 | 步骤 | 操作 | 代码示
原创 2024-07-03 04:38:23
171阅读
前言:承接上篇数据库基础增删改查操作。文章以students表为例1,查询练习:select * from students ; select 表别名.字段 .... from 表名 as 表别名; #例:可以给表起别名,查询表的name字段 select s.name from students as s; distinct 字段 去重 #例:性别去重 select distinc
plist文件真机写入方法 但是这对真机不管用,因为在真机环境下,App在Xcode中的Resources文件夹都是不可 ...关于js unshift&lpar;&rpar; 与pop&lpar;&rpar; 功能最近在研究如何精简贪吃蛇代码,网上许多大神已经将其精简到30行之内就可以搞定. 我尝试着学习并且研究是否能进一步精简的方式. 偶然间又重新温习了一遍p
MySQL基础教程2-DQL(select查询) MySQL基础教程2-DQL(select查询) select查询 理解: 根据某一指定属性对前面select之后的运算进行分组执行 例如: select age,avg(id) from user group by age; 解释:分别求出各年龄(age)段的id平均值 本小节知识清单: max() count() avg() min() sum
# MySQL:获取小于30秒前的记录 在常见的数据库管理系统中,MySQL是最流行的之一。无论是在小型应用程序还是大型商业系统中,MySQL都能以其高效和灵活性满足各种需求。在实际应用中,有时我们需要从数据库中查询某个时间点之前的数据,比如获取小于30秒前的记录。本文将通过示例与图表,帮助你了解如何实现这一功能。 ## 查询小于30秒前的记录 为了从数据库中获取小于30秒前的数据,我们通常
原创 2024-09-03 03:53:12
56阅读
下面来详细的说明,不一定准确不一定完整,请多包含或者提出您的建议,我很乐意倾听,呵呵. 数字列类型 int、bigint、smallint、tinyint   数字列类型用于储存各种数字数据,如价格、年龄或者数量。数字列类型主要分为两种:整数型和浮点型。所有的数字列类型都允许有两个选 项:UNSIGNED和ZEROFILL。选择UNSIGNED的列不允许有负数,选择了ZEROFILL的列会为数值
转载 2024-04-24 20:02:56
24阅读
Sutdent表的定义字段名字段描述数据类型主键外键非空唯一自增Id学号INT(10)是否是是是Name姓名VARCHAR(20)否否是否否Sex性别VARCHAR(4)否否否否否Birth出生年份YEAR否否否否否Department院系VARCHAR(20)否否是否否Address家庭住址VARCHAR(50)否否否否否Score表的定义字段名字段描述数据类型主键外键非空唯一自增Id编号INT
表准备 create table emp( id intnotnull unique auto_increment, name varchar(20) notnull, sex enum('male','female') not null default 'male', #大部分是男的 age int(3) unsigned not null default 28, hire_date daten
  • 1
  • 2
  • 3
  • 4
  • 5